It’s only been two weeks since Chris Brown released the tracklist for his upcoming album, Fortune. But at the rate his promo train has been going, there won’t be anything new to listen to by the time it hits stores on June 29.

Just days after his high-energy appearance on the Today Show, the “Oh Yeah” singer dropped by BET’s 106 & Park on Monday (June 11) to premiere his Inception-style “Don’t Wake Me Up” music video. He also talked about his supportive fans, living as an “everyday person,” and Instagram-ing his new Grammy before answering questions from Team Breezy. Watch him above and below.
